[Résolu] Mise à jour PHP sur les pages perso Free

  • WordPress :5.2
  • Statut : résolu
6 sujets de 1 à 6 (sur un total de 6)
  • Auteur
    Messages
  • #2273421
    phcado
    Participant
    Initié WordPress
    4 contributions

    Bonjour,

    deux mots de présentation : Philippe, 53 ans, professeur des écoles. Après avoir utilisé d’autres CMS (Spip, DNN), je me lance dans WordPress.

    Je connais un peu l’ergonomie générale de WP en tant que contributeur au site de mon club de plongée (sagc-plongee.fr) mais c’est des copains qui l’ont mis en place chez OVH.

    Comme je dispose de pages perso chez Free, dont une (fil.cado.free.fr) où j’avais mis en place un SPIP pour faire un blog de voyage, j’ai décidé d’y faire du ménage. J’ai supprimé en FTP le contenu, et j’ai effacé avec Phpmyadmin toutes les tables.

    J’ai téléchargé, décompressé, et transféré avec FileZilla WP sur ces pages perso.

    Mais je rencontre le problème suivant :

    Votre serveur utilise la version 5.1.3RC4-dev de PHP mais WordPress 5.2.2 nécessite au moins la version 5.6.20.

    Je précise qu’avant d’ouvrir ce post j’ai essayé de suivre les instructions données dans cet ancien topic

    https://wpfr.net/support/sujet/information-maj-php-5-6-et-installation-wordpress-chez-free-fr/

    mais comme il est un peu ancien et qu’il comporte déjà 6 pages et 76 interventions, j’ai pris la liberté d’ouvrir un nouveau sujet…

    En référence à ce que j’y avais trouvé, j’ai bien essayé de modifier mon .htaccess pour y mettre

    php 5620

    au lieu du

    php 561

    indiqué par le sujet d’alors mais …

    Quelqu’un aurait-il une idée pour m’aider ?

    En vous remerciant par avance

    #2273422
    C_Lucien
    Modérateur
    Maître WordPress
    4250 contributions

    Bonjour,

    la page consacrée aux pages perso de Free a été mise à jour en avril 2019 ; elle annonçait la mise en place de Php 5.6.34 pour une période de tests. Puis passage à Php 7.3.x

    Pour se tenir informé de l’actualité des pages perso de Free, le seul canal reste Usenet. Il faut s’y abonner via un lecteur de news (Thunderbird) et suivre les procédures prescrites.

    Reste à savoir si WordPress fonctionnera sans anicroche sur cet environnement bridé.

    #2273459
    phcado
    Participant
    Initié WordPress
    4 contributions

    Merci pour ta réponse si rapide.

    Ai-je bien compris si je dis que “s’abonner à Usenet via un lecteur de news” c’est “configurer dans Thunderbird un compte sur les discussions news.free.fr”.

    C’est ce que je viens de faire, mais il me faut alors m’abonner à un groupe de discussion, et il y en a près de 45000 !! J’ai fait une recherche parmi ces groupes sur “php”, et je me suis abonné au petit bonheur à la chance à 5 groupes, mais je n’y ai trouvé aucune discussion qui puisse m’aider.

    Est-ce ce que je devais faire ?

    Si oui quelqu’un peut-il m’indiquer un nom de groupe où j’ai des chances de trouver ce que je cherche ?

    Cdt

    #2273460
    phcado
    Participant
    Initié WordPress
    4 contributions

    Oups…

    Parlé trop vite peut-être. Je viens de m’abonner à proxad.free.services.pagesperso, ça a l’air de causer de choses intéressantes pour mon cas.

    Désolé pour le bruit…

    #2273463
    phcado
    Participant
    Initié WordPress
    4 contributions

    Effectivement, j’y ai trouvé mon info : il fallait (par rapport à ce qui est écrit dans le sujet auquel je fais référence dans mon premier post) bien indiquer dans le .htaccess l’instruction

    php 56 1

    mais l’entourer de deux balises dans les pages perso Free

    <IfDefine Free>
    php56 1
    </IfDefine>

    Merci de votre aide

    #2273483
    C_Lucien
    Modérateur
    Maître WordPress
    4250 contributions

    re,

    tant mieux si ça marche. J’ajoute une petite “cerise sur le gâteau”, un fichier .htaccess contenant toutes les recommandations pour faire fonctionner au mieux un site WordPress sur ces pages perso. Les infos viennent du site recommandé plus haut, et aussi un peu dispersées sur le groupe Usenet. Pour avoir dû une fois remettre en ordre de marche un site piraté, j’ai préféré me le mettre de côté.

    # Spécification des jeux de caractères des documents (ajoutez les extensions que vous utilisez)
    AddCharset utf-8 .css .xml .po .php .js
    
    # activation php5 (free.fr)
    <ifDefine Free>
     PHP56 1
    </ifDefine>
    
    # Protection du fichier .htaccess
    <Files .htaccess>
    Order Deny,Allow
    Deny from all
    </Files>
    
    # Protection du fichier wp-config.php
    <files wp-config.php>
    order Deny,Allow
    deny from all
    </files>
    
    # Désactivation de l'affichage des répertoires
    Options All -Indexes
    
    # Inactivation des rewrite rule de WordPress sur FREE.
    <IfDefine !Free>
    # BEGIN WordPress
    
    # END WordPress
    </IfDefine>
    Free_special_htaccess

    Une mise en garde primordiale, avant de mettre en place ce fichier, ne tentez jamais de modifier les permaliens. Parfois, le simple fait d’afficher la page d’administration suffit à planter le site. Une des règles dans le .htaccess empêche justement cette réécriture.

6 sujets de 1 à 6 (sur un total de 6)
  • Vous devez être connecté pour répondre à ce sujet.